Regarding priority measures such as prevention of the spread of new corona measures, the government has decided to extend it until the 21st of this month in 18 prefectures such as Tokyo, and to cancel it in 13 prefectures such as Fukuoka with a deadline of 6 days.

On the night of the 4th, the government carried out the new Coronavirus Countermeasures Headquarters in a rotating manner.



Regarding the priority measures such as spread prevention applied to 31 prefectures, 18 prefectures such as Tokyo, Osaka, and Aichi still have high bed usage rates, and it is necessary to continue measures this month. I decided to extend it for more than two weeks until the 21st.



On the other hand, in 13 prefectures such as Fukuoka and Hiroshima, the infection situation has settled down, and we have decided to cancel it with a deadline of 6 days.

Border measures Raise the maximum number of immigrants to 7,000 per day

The government has changed the basic policy for measures against the new corona, and has added new measures such as raising the upper limit of the number of immigrants to 7,000 per day from 14th of this month.

A new framework apart from the upper limit also gives priority to accepting foreign students

In the changed basic coping policy, the upper limit of the number of immigrants who raised the number of immigrants from the 1st of this month to 5,000 per day will be further raised to 7,000 per day from the 14th of this month, and apart from this upper limit. We will establish a new framework and prioritize and steadily accept foreign students.

Characteristics of Omicron strain Included for comparison with seasonal influenza

In addition, the characteristics of the Omicron strain are newly included in the comparison with seasonal influenza.



Specifically, it is suggested that the case fatality rate of the Omicron strain is higher than that of seasonal influenza, and that the incidence of pneumonia is also high, although the data is limited, while further data collection and analysis are required in the future. It is said that a tentative opinion has been reported.
